Number: 116108820
Country: Poland
Source: ezamowienia.gov.pl
Number: 115894506
Number: 115904379
Number: 115826355
Number: 115609191
Number: 115537995
Number: 115469651
Number: 115281269
Number: 115077365
Number: 114738781
Number: 114687385
Number: 113653807
Number: 113509541
Number: 113100189
Number: 111534397
Number: 111103283
Number: 110628195
Number: 110630631
Number: 110319614
Number: 109669341
Number: 154397
Country: Germany
Number: 154398
Country: United Kingdom
Source: TED
Number: 154399
Number: 154400
Country: France
Number: 154401
Number: 154402
Country: Austria